For Your Sake is a raw and intimate drama that delves into the life of Zulma, a teenager stuck in the rigid expectations of her rural upbringing. The film captures that suffocating atmosphere of small-town life beautifully, using natural lighting and practical effects to create an authentic feeling of place.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ing space for Zulma's internal struggle to resonate. Performances are quite compelling, especially the lead, who embodies the conflict between duty and self-actualization. It’s distinct in its exploration of how one event can shift the course of a young person's life, poking at themes of autonomy and identity in a setting that feels both stifling and familiar.
